Gouken is powerful enough to be capable of performing a Gohadoken with only one hand, is able to perform a similar Ashura Senku move, but with an offensive twist, the Senkugoshoha , has perfected an anti-aerial vertical Tatsumaki Senpukyaku, the Tatsumaki Gorasen , and has a powerful counter move, Kongoshin , that is able to counter nearly any attack with lightning-fast oppressive force.

Furthermore, he shares the Airborne Tatsumaki Senpukyaku of his students from the Street Fighter II series and the Hyakkishu of his brother with a different variation, and shares his brother's Tenmakujinkyaku.

His throw, Ama no Oroshi, is a simple subduing hug before Gouken tosses them into the air, and is useful for starting up aerial juggles. As the master of the toned-down assassination art, Gouken appears to have specialized in the usage of the Shoryuken, to the point that they are only available as Super Combos and Ultra Combos, in the forms of the Forbidden Shoryuken , while his first Ultra Combo is the Shin Shoryuken , and the Hadoken, as using both hands allows him to perform the Denjin Hadoken with a greater deal of power.

His boss counterpart in Super Street Fighter IV , has powered up special moves quite similar to that of playable Gouken's EX moves and sports a light blue-green gi. The Gohadoken projectiles are immediately and fully charged, which means they always land two hits.

The Kongoshin can react to both high and low hits, eliminating the need to guess. The Denjin Hadoken is also fully charged upon activation. Gouken also appeared in the Street Fighter episode " The World's Greatest Warrior ", with his character design being similar to that in prior Street Fighter manga. Gouken and Akuma are training together under Goutetsu's teachings, at some point, Akuma had turned to the dark side to grow in power and throwing away his humanity for the Dark Hado after murdering Goutetsu, this event causes the two brothers' relationship to strain.

At some point, he takes in Ryu as a pupil along with Ken, and teaches them the art of Ansatsuken, he is eventually murdered by Akuma in front of Ryu who tried to help Gouken. Although not exactly canon the comics have been influenced by the games and vice versa. During his younger days, Gouken committed himself to training after seeing his family murdered.

The assailants were people who had a hatred for his father, who used the Dark Hado to murder the leader of the bandit gang's father. Gouken came to Goutetsu 's temple after seeing his mother's life fade away from an unknown sickness, and Goutetsu agreed to teach him after hearing his reasons for learning Ansatsuken. After passing many trials and tests from Goutetsu's teachings, his final trial was to stay in the mountains with no food or water for days as a mental endurance test.

Retsu reveals himself to Gouken and another student of Goutetsu that had stayed in the mountains and tells Gouken that he has been in the mountains for ten days and has reached enlightenment. He leads Gouken to the village of the bandits that murdered his father.

Gouken, having no desire for revenge, did not go after them. He asked Retsu about the other student who was in the mountains with that lasted as long as he did. Retsu told him that it was his brother, Gouki. When the village and the bar was on fire due to the attack from Gouki under the influence of the Dark Hado, Gouken found a woman with an infant in the burning bar. He saved the baby from the place before it burned to the ground.

Gouken then raised the boy as his son and named him Ryu. He also would train the son of an American businessman, Ken Masters, much in the same way. At some point, he was visited by Retsu who told him the stories of what became of his brother. He told him Gouki has cast away his humanity and became Akuma.

Many villagers and fighters feared Akuma and thought of him as a demon that was cast down from the heavens to destroy everything. After hearing about the people who had lost their lives to Akuma, Gouken sets out on a personal journey to find him near the river, only to find that he brother had truly become a demon after all. Telling Gouken that he would be better off alive if he went with Akuma, Gouken is enraged by Akuma a the two begin to engage in combat.

After attack with a ki-charged Shoryuken, Akuma falls near a waterfall. Gouken wanted to save him from failing into the waterfall, but Akuma denies his help and drops in. He surveries the tital wave and climbs out of the river, revealing to Gouken his intention to one day fight against another person who uses the Dark Hado.

Gouken maintains a different philosophy then that his brother, his brother believing that the only true path to mastery and perfection can only be gained by throwing away humanity, love, loyality, and compassion.

Gouken believes that true mastery can be achive through goodness, peace, and honor, and this eventually leads the brothers to argue over the future of Ryu's destiny. Sometime after that event, Gouken was visited in the middle of the night at his dojo by another unwelcome visitor, whose aura was akin to that of a pure, threatening, empty shadow. Though he did not introduce himself, that entity was that of a younger M. Bison , and he demanded Gouken to show to him the techniques of Ansatsuken, having heard of its reputation through rumors and word of mouth.

Forced to duel with the threatening figure, Gouken ultimately lost the fight, but won the battle, having held back and refusing to show Bison any of his techniques.

However, Bison made word that he would one day encounter his two students, and ultimately reveal to him the secrets of Ansatsuken and its principles of Hadou; though beaten badly and fallen unconscious shortly afterwards, as if the events were nothing but a bad dream, Gouken knew irrevocably that his students would not be able to resist that fate of encountering Bison, and was driven to teach them to the best of his abilities in turn.

During Ryu's absence from the dojo to attend the first Street Fighter tournament, Akuma murders Gouken by using the Raging Demon, unaware that Gouken used the Power of Nothingness to protect his soul. As Akuma seeks to have Ryu embrace the Dark Hado for the remainder of the comic series, Gouken remained absent. Ryu forces himself to not show the hatred that wells up within him, adhering to his master's precepts of humanity and respect for one's opponent.
